What Are Ghost Gun Magazines?

The phrase “ghost gun magazines” is not a formally defined legal term, but it is often used in online discussions to describe magazines associated with privately assembled or unserialized firearm builds.

A magazine, in general, is a component that stores and feeds ammunition into a firearm. The “ghost gun” label is typically applied in discussions where the firearm itself may not originate from traditional serialized manufacturing processes.

It’s important to note that while the term is widely used online, its meaning can vary depending on context, media usage, and legal interpretation.

Legal Considerations and Regulations

When it comes to magazines, laws often focus on factors such as:

  • Capacity limits (number of rounds a magazine can hold)

  • Restrictions in certain states or regions

  • Rules around possession, transfer, or modification

Unlike other firearm components, magazines are typically regulated based on capacity and local laws rather than serialization.

However, laws vary widely depending on jurisdiction, and regulations can change over time. What is permitted in one location may be restricted in another.
